Output 3bf3ef8debe22c75685858eaf8a83c070016e736c6e24b4b57e0e76a896675a6:1

value
2514486
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f9d7a2133f3356d2137bedaa4a25ee74f189fa0 OP_EQUALVERIFY OP_CHECKSIG
address
1E6NH8ZSpYsHVRidzGfRqthQkMjPN3XA6d
transaction
3bf3ef8debe22c75685858eaf8a83c070016e736c6e24b4b57e0e76a896675a6